Summary:
The city of Plainfield, Wisconsin is home to three schools in the Tri-County Area School District: Tri-County Elementary, Tri-County High, and Tri-County Middle. Based on the available data, these schools appear to be performing below the state average on various metrics, with low statewide rankings and ratings.
None of the Plainfield schools stand out as clear performers, with all three schools ranked in the bottom 25-30% of their respective school types in Wisconsin. The schools have significantly lower proficiency rates compared to the state average in core subjects like English Language Arts, Mathematics, Social Studies, and Science. Additionally, the schools face challenges with high chronic absenteeism rates, around 17.7% for the 2023-2024 school year.
The Plainfield schools also serve a high percentage of economically disadvantaged students, with free/reduced lunch rates ranging from 53.85% at Tri-County High to around 67% at Tri-County Elementary and Tri-County Middle. This suggests that the district may be facing significant socioeconomic challenges that could be impacting student performance.
